How the Assault AirBike Elite Helps You Lose Weight
1. Burns a Massive Amount of Calories
The Assault AirBike Elite is a calorie-incinerating machine. Unlike steady-state cardio machines like ellipticals or treadmills, the AirBike responds to your effort. The harder you go, the more calories you burn.
For example:
A moderate-paced 30-minute workout can burn around 300-500 calories.
An intense HIIT session (15-20 minutes) can burn 400-600+ calories, with an afterburn effect that keeps your metabolism elevated for hours.
2. Engages Multiple Muscle Groups
One of the best things about the AirBike Elite is that it doesn’t just work your legs like a traditional bike. Every push, pull, and pedal recruits your:
Quadriceps, hamstrings, and calves
Glutes and core
Shoulders, chest, and arms This full-body engagement increases calorie burn and builds lean muscle, which helps you burn more fat even when you’re at rest.
3. Perfect for HIIT and Tabata Workouts
If you want to lose weight fast, HIIT is the way to go. The Assault AirBike Elite excels at short bursts of intense work followed by brief recovery periods. Here’s a simple Tabata workout to try:
20 seconds: All-out sprint
10 seconds: Slow recovery
Repeat for 8 rounds (4 minutes total)
Rest for 1-2 minutes, repeat if you’re feeling brave
This method is scientifically proven to burn fat more effectively than steady-state cardio in a fraction of the time.
4. Encourages Fat Loss Without Muscle Loss
Traditional cardio can sometimes burn muscle along with fat. Since the Assault AirBike involves resistance training as well, it helps preserve muscle mass while stripping away fat. This means you’ll get leaner without sacrificing strength.

How to Incorporate the Assault AirBike Into Your Routine
Beginner Workout (Endurance Focus)
5-minute warm-up at an easy pace
30 seconds: Moderate pace
30 seconds: Slow pace (recovery)
Repeat for 20-30 minutes
5-minute cooldown
Intermediate Workout (Fat-Burning Focus)
5-minute warm-up
40 seconds: Hard effort
20 seconds: Slow pace
Repeat for 15-20 minutes
5-minute cooldown
Advanced Workout (HIIT Burnout)
5-minute warm-up
10 seconds: MAX effort
20 seconds: Slow pace
Repeat for 8-10 rounds
3-minute easy pace recovery
Repeat for 3-5 rounds total
